PortugalDidn't like the pillow. Maybe there are alternatives at the reception. Following the GPS doesn't work very well. Better to follow the main road to Mire de Tibaes and then the road straight to the Monastery.
Excellent stay just 10min from Braga in a fantastic monastery. The place has less than 20 rooms and the hotel takes only a small part of the old monastery. The monastery was recently recovered and worth a visit - free for hotel guests. The hotel renovation is amazing and everywhere you look you notice the attention to detail by the architect. As a bonus, the monastery as large farm and gardens that are excellent for a walk.

United States of AmericaRestaurant was not open the day we were there, so we travelled into town to buy food at a local store
This is not a typical hotel. A monk’s cell in a former monastery has been converted into a modern hotel room with WIFI. Behind a glass partition, you can see the stone window seat where a monk would have worked by daylight hundreds of years ago. The bathroom wall is glass, so light from the bathroom illuminates the rest of the room—there is a curtain, though, if privacy is desired. All in all a unique experience.
